<span>The Realism perspective worships the state and its ruler's sovereign freedom, ignoring the role of leaders and nongovernmental organizations (NGO) that people form. Realism is a study approach and exercise of universal politics. It stresses the role of the state of the nation and makes a wide theory that all state of the nation is driven by general benefits. National benefits masked as moral concerns.</span>

The Christianity, more specifically the Catholic Christianity, was spread in Mexico mostly by force. This task was performed by the Catholic missionaries, with the assistance of the military. They were forcing the local population to get converted and leave their own native religion behind them, and the methods were anything from verbal persuasion, to torture, and even murder of the ones that were not willing to accept the new faith. The missionaries went so far that they even destroyed pretty much everything (apart from 4 pieces) written about the Mayan religion in an attempt to show their superiority, and also to leave the natives without any basis so that they can continue to practice it.

The term <u>Lost Generation</u> was used by writer Gertrude Stein to describe those left deeply disillusioned by World War I.
Explanation:
The generation was “lost” in the sense that its inherited values were no longer relevant in the postwar world and because of its spiritual alienation from the United States.
